Recently booked in Jaipur
Punch Ball
Punch Ball
Mechanical Bull Ride
Mechanical Bull Ride
Tic Tac Toe Game Inflatable
Tic Tac Toe Game Inflatable
Live Streaming Video Services
Live Streaming Video Services